Educational Inequality and Financial Supports of Higher Education in UK

1 Introduction

Education inequality can be divided into three situation—socio-economic inequality, gender inequality and ethic inequality (Hanhum, Buchmann, 2005). This essay is going to talk about educational inequality from the perspective of socio-economic inequality. First, it will analyze the problems and then give relevant solutions according to the causes. Last, it will make a conclusion that is educational equality can be received in terms of financial supports.
2 Situation

In UK, a growing number of students recently have been rejected by university because of their inability to meet the financial guarantee. The phenomenon reveals that higher education gives edge to the students from higher socio-economic classes, which means that HE funds has been distributed disproportionately (Blanden, Machin, 2004).However, for the students without sufficient financial supports, receiving higher education seems to be the only and reliable approach for them to improve their, even their family’s, financial condition. But that is not always the case. Some arguments go against this idea and note that university degree is not equal to a successful career, whereas as one kind of soft power of a nation, education is crucial for both individuals and nation.
